Shadowsocks Tcpdump教程:网络代理与流量分析完全指南

简介

在今天的互联网环境中,网络代理和流量分析变得越来越重要。Shadowsocks和Tcpdump是两个强大的工具,可以帮助用户实现安全的网络代理和对网络流量进行详尽分析。本文将深入探讨这两个工具的原理、用法以及常见问题。

Shadowsocks简介

Shadowsocks是一个基于SOCKS5代理协议的网络代理工具,它能够有效地穿透防火墙,提供安全稳定的网络访问。Shadowsocks通过混淆和加密技术,能够有效地保护用户的隐私和数据安全。

Shadowsocks的特点

  • 高效的网络代理工具
  • 支持多种加密算法
  • 跨平台支持
  • 开源免费

如何使用Shadowsocks

  1. 下载并安装Shadowsocks客户端
  2. 配置Shadowsocks客户端,填入服务器地址、端口和密码
  3. 启动Shadowsocks客户端,开始安全的网络代理

Tcpdump简介

Tcpdump是一个网络流量分析工具,可以捕获和分析网络数据包,帮助用户深入了解网络流量情况。Tcpdump可以用于网络故障排除、安全审计等多种场景。

Tcpdump的特点

  • 强大的网络数据包捕获和分析功能
  • 支持多种过滤器和输出格式
  • 灵活易用

如何使用Tcpdump

  1. 在终端中输入sudo tcpdump -i <interface>命令,开始捕获网络数据包
  2. 根据需要添加过滤器,以过滤特定的网络流量
  3. 分析捕获的数据包,获取所需信息

网络代理与流量分析的应用

网络代理和流量分析在实际应用中有着广泛的用途,包括但不限于:

  • 突破网络封锁,访问被封锁的网站
  • 加密网络流量,保护用户隐私
  • 监控网络流量,发现异常行为
  • 网络故障排除和优化

常见问题FAQ

Shadowsocks常见问题

1. Shadowsocks如何选择合适的加密算法?

可以根据实际需求和性能要求选择合适的加密算法,常见的算法包括AES、RC4等。

2. 如何解决Shadowsocks连接速度慢的问题?

可以尝试更换服务器、调整加密算法或优化网络环境来提高连接速度。

Tcpdump常见问题

1. 如何只捕获特定IP地址的流量?

可以使用tcpdump host <ip>命令来只捕获特定IP地址的流量。

2. Tcpdump如何保存捕获的数据包?

可以使用tcpdump -w <file>命令将捕获的数据包保存到文件中。

正文完